The latest update is out from Coca Cola HBC ( (GB:CCH) ).

Coca-Cola HBC has reported a series of share purchases by senior executives under its Employee Share Purchase Plan, with the company making matching contributions in line with plan rules. The transactions, involving CEO Zoran Bogdanovic and other PDMRs, modestly increase insider equity holdings and signal continued emphasis on equity-based remuneration and alignment of management interests with shareholders.

The deals were executed on 17 April 2026 on the London Stock Exchange at a price of £43.53006 per share and cover both employee-funded and company-funded acquisitions. While the volumes are relatively small in the context of the group’s overall capital structure, the activity underlines ongoing use of share ownership schemes as part of Coca-Cola HBC’s retention and incentive strategy for key management.

More about Coca Cola HBC

Coca-Cola HBC AG is a leading beverage bottler and strategic partner of The Coca-Cola Company, producing and distributing soft drinks and related non-alcoholic beverages. The group operates across multiple European and adjacent markets, focusing on branded ready-to-drink products sold through retail and out-of-home channels.
